5B/5C Mole worksheet for marks

1. Deneil is provided with two solutions, M and N. Solution M is aqueous hydrochloric acid containing 3.6 g dm-3. Solution N is an
aqueous solution of sodium hydroxide which has been prepared using a certain mass of sodium hydroxide in 1 dm3 of solution.
Deneil was asked to titrate solution M against 25 cm3 of solution N in order to determine the concentration of sodium hydroxide. It
was found that 22 cm3 of solution M was required to neutralise 25 cm3 of solution N.

a) Write a balanced chemical equation for the reaction between solution M and solution N. [1]

….…………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………..

b) Calculate the molar concentration of solution M. [2] Ar H = 1, Cl = 35.5

….…………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………..

c) Calculate the number of moles of hydrochloric acid used in the titration. [1]

….…………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………..

d) Calculate the molar concentration of solution N. [2]

….…………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………..

e) Calculate the mass concentration of solution N. Note the molar mass of sodium hydroxide is 40 g mol -1 [1]

2. 1 g of CaCO3 chips was reacted with excess hydrochloric acid and the carbon dioxide gas produced was captured in a gas syringe
in order for its volume to be measured.

a) Calculate the #mol CaCO3 present in 1 g of CaCO3. [1] Ar Ca=40, C=12, O=16

….…………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………………….

b) Complete AND balance the equation for the reaction of CaCO 3 and HCl. [1]

_______ CaCO3 + ____HCl --> __________ + ____CO2 + _________

c) Calculate the volume of CO2 produced and thus captured at rtp. Note 1 mole of any gas occupies 24 dm3 at rtp
